[发明专利]文件分发的处理方法及装置、存储介质、终端在审
| 申请号: | 202111602442.X | 申请日: | 2021-12-24 |
| 公开(公告)号: | CN114329540A | 公开(公告)日: | 2022-04-12 |
| 发明(设计)人: | 张怡;李振伟 | 申请(专利权)人: | 奇安信科技集团股份有限公司;网神信息技术(北京)股份有限公司 |
| 主分类号: | G06F21/60 | 分类号: | G06F21/60;G06F21/62 |
| 代理公司: | 北京中强智尚知识产权代理有限公司 11448 | 代理人: | 刘敏 |
| 地址: | 100032 北京市西城区*** | 国省代码: | 北京;11 |
| 权利要求书: | 查看更多 | 说明书: | 查看更多 |
| 摘要: | |||
| 搜索关键词: | 文件 分发 处理 方法 装置 存储 介质 终端 | ||
1.一种文件分发的处理方法,其特征在于,包括:
将执行至少一项文件分发任务的操作内容配置于目标系统服务进程中,所述目标系统服务进程为提供系统安全服务的系统进程;
当接收到目标文件分发任务时,调取所述目标系统服务进程;
通过所述目标系统服务进程执行所述目标文件分发任务所对应的操作内容,以加载运行所述目标文件分发任务的分发文件。
2.根据权利要求1所述的方法,其特征在于,所述将执行至少一项文件分发任务的操作内容配置于目标系统服务进程中包括:
获取具有不同分发属性的分发操作内容,并对所述分发操作内容进行拆分,得到拆分后执行至少一项文件分发任务所对应的操作内容、以及执行至少一项软件分发任务所对应的操作内容,所述分发属性包括文件分发、软件分发;
将所述执行文件分发任务所对应的操作内容存储于独立属性的系统文件中,并将所述系统文件配置于所述目标系统服务进程中;
将所述执行软件分发任务所对应的操作内容存储于与所述分发操作内容对应的原始文件中。
3.根据权利要求2所述的方法,其特征在于,所述将所述执行文件分发任务所对应的操作内容存储于独立属性的系统文件中包括:
获取执行文件分发任务所对应的软件运行权限,所述软件运行权限包括标准用户权限、管理账户权限、系统权限、安全服务权限;
若所述软件运行权限匹配预设运行权限,则将所述软件运行权限所对应执行文件分发任务的操作内容存储于独立属性的系统文件中。
4.根据权利要求3所述的方法,其特征在于,所述调取所述目标系统服务进程包括:
若检测用户状态为未登陆,则调取所述目标系统服务进程;和/或,
若检测软件运行权限匹配预设运行权限,则调取所述目标系统服务进程;
所述通过所述目标系统服务进程执行所述目标文件分发任务所对应的操作内容包括:
从所述目标系统服务进程中提取所述系统文件;
确定所述系统文件中执行所述目标文件分发任务的操作内容,并在所述目标系统服务进程中执行所述操作内容对所述目标文件分发任务的目标分发文件进行加载运行。
5.根据权利要求4所述的方法,其特征在于,所述确定所述系统文件中执行所述目标文件分发任务的操作内容,并在所述目标系统服务进程中执行所述操作内容对所述目标文件分发任务的目标分发文件进行加载运行包括:
获取所述目标分发文件的运行程序版本、运行环境、运行安全特征;
按照所述运行程序版本、所述运行环境、所述运行安全特征从所述系统文件中提取执行所述目标文件分发任务所对应的子操作内容,所述系统文件中存储有包含多个子操作内容的操作内容;
在所述目标系统服务进程中基于所述子操作内容对所述目标文件分发任务的目标分发文件进行加载运行。
6.根据权利要求1所述的方法,其特征在于,所述通过所述目标系统服务进程执行所述目标文件分发任务所对应的操作内容之后,所述方法还包括:
检测执行所述目标文件分发任务所对应的配置文件信息、和/或注册表信息是否匹配预设文件执行条件;
若配置文件信息、和/或注册表信息匹配预设文件执行条件,则发送文件任务分发结果至服务端,以指示完成所述分发文件的文件分发任务。
7.根据权利要求1-6任一项所述的方法,其特征在于,所述通过所述目标系统服务进程执行所述目标文件分发任务所对应的操作内容之后,所述方法还包括:
检测已加载运行的目标分发文件与系统安全运行需求是否匹配,所述系统安全运行需求包括系统文件执行安全内容、操作行为执行安全内容、存储空间运行安全内容中至少一项;
若已加载运行的目标分发文件与系统安全运行需求不匹配,则向服务端发送文件分发任务请求,所述文件分发任务请求中携带有所述系统安全运行需求,以使所述服务端基于所述系统安全运行需求确定分发文件。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于奇安信科技集团股份有限公司;网神信息技术(北京)股份有限公司,未经奇安信科技集团股份有限公司;网神信息技术(北京)股份有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202111602442.X/1.html,转载请声明来源钻瓜专利网。





